HD KSOE reaches 50% of order target in two months

South Korea’s top shipbuilder HD Korea Shipbuilding & Offshore Engineering (HD KSOE) announced on Monday that it signed shipbuilding contracts worth a total of 586.6 billion won ($440 million).

The company won contracts with two medium-sized liquefied petroleum gas carriers (LPGCs) from a European shipping company and four petrochemical carriers (PC ships) from an Oceania-based shipping firm.

The LPGCs and PC ships will be constructed at Hyundai Mipo Dockyard Co. in Ulsan and Hyundai Vietnam Shipyard. The vessels are scheduled to be delivered to the shipowners by December 2026 and June 2027.

HD KSOE, HD Hyundai Group’s intermediate holding company for the shipbuilding business, has secured a total of 58 vessels, amounting to $7.16 billion this year, achieving 53% of its annual target of $13.5 billion.

HD KSOE inked deals to produce six LPGCs, 21 PC ships, 21 LPG and ammonia carriers, one ethane carrier, two liquefied carbon dioxide carriers, two very large crude carriers (VLCCs), two tankers, two pure car and truck carriers (PCTC); and 1 offshore facility.
